    Understanding the Foundation of Your Garden

    Understanding the Foundation of Your Garden

    Every successful garden starts from the ground up. The dirt you plant your seeds in dictates how well they will germinate, grow, and eventually produce food. When you provide the right environment, vegetables develop deep root systems, resist disease, and yield massive harvests.

    The Components of Great Soil

    Good garden dirt is never just dirt. It represents a living, breathing ecosystem comprised of five main building blocks. Minerals provide the physical structure, creating sand, silt, or clay textures. Organic matter consists of broken-down plant material that feeds organisms and holds moisture. Living organisms include billions of bacteria, fungi, and earthworms that break down nutrients. Finally, water and air make up almost half of the volume in healthy ground, allowing roots to breathe and drink.

    The Role of Macronutrients

    Vegetables are heavy feeders. They pull massive amounts of nutrients from the ground to produce leaves, flowers, and fruit. Nitrogen powers vegetative growth, giving plants their lush green color. Phosphorus stimulates strong root development and flower blooming. Potassium strengthens plant immunity and improves the quality of the fruit. Without a proper balance of these three macronutrients, your plants will suffer from stunted growth, yellowing leaves, and poor yields.

    How to Test and Evaluate Your Ground

    Before adding anything to your garden, you must understand what you already have. Testing your ground prevents you from wasting money on unnecessary amendments and helps you pinpoint exactly what your vegetables need.

    The Importance of Testing

    Sending a sample to a local Extension Office gives you a precise breakdown of your nutrient levels and organic matter content. This scientific approach removes the guesswork. You will find out exactly how much phosphorus, potassium, and calcium you have. More importantly, a test reveals your soil pH, which dictates how well plants can absorb nutrients. Most vegetables prefer a pH between 6.5 and 6.8. If your ground is too acidic or alkaline, nutrients become locked away, effectively starving your plants even if the nutrients are present.

    Simple Home Tests

    If you cannot send a sample to a lab, you can perform simple tests at home. The squeeze test helps you determine your texture. Take a handful of moist dirt and squeeze it. If it holds its shape perfectly and feels sticky, you have heavy clay. If it crumbles immediately, you have sandy soil. The ideal loamy texture holds its shape but crumbles easily when poked. You can also dig a hole, fill it with water, and time how long it takes to drain to evaluate your drainage capacity.

    Essential Amendments for Maximum Production

    Once you know what your ground lacks, you can begin the process of improvement. Building the ideal soil for vegetable gardening requires a multi-pronged approach using high-quality natural amendments.

    Harnessing the Power of Organic Matter

    Adding organic matter is the single best thing you can do for your garden. High-quality compost acts as a cure-all. It loosens heavy clay, helps sandy ground retain moisture, and introduces billions of beneficial microbes. You should incorporate generous amounts of decayed plant matter into your beds every single year. You can buy bagged products, but making your own from kitchen scraps, autumn leaves, and yard waste saves money and creates a closed-loop system in your backyard.

    Utilizing Natural Fertilizers

    Vegetables deplete the ground rapidly. To replenish these lost nutrients, you must use a reliable organic fertilizer. Unlike synthetic chemicals that wash away and damage microbes, natural fertilizers feed the ground slowly. Blood meal provides an excellent source of nitrogen. Bone meal delivers crucial phosphorus. Kelp meal introduces trace minerals and potassium. Adding a balanced granular fertilizer every time you plant ensures your vegetables have the fuel they need for vigorous growth.

    The Strategy for Elevated Growing

    The Strategy for Elevated Growing

    Many gardeners struggle with rocky, poor-draining native dirt. If your native ground makes growing difficult, you can bypass the problem entirely by building upward.

    Why You Should Grow Upward

    Utilizing raised beds solves a multitude of common gardening problems. Elevated frames allow you to control the exact composition of your growing medium from day one. You never have to battle heavy clay or dig through limestone rocks. They warm up faster in the spring, allowing you to plant earlier. They also drain exceptionally well, preventing waterlogged roots during heavy spring rains. Furthermore, they reduce physical strain, requiring less bending and kneeling.

    Choosing the Right Materials

    When constructing elevated frames, use untreated wood, cedar, or galvanized steel. Avoid chemically treated wood near food crops. Line the bottom with cardboard or newspaper to suppress weeds while allowing earthworms to migrate upward. You can also place small logs and branches at the very bottom to bulk up the volume and provide long-term carbon breakdown, a method known as hugelkultur.

    Comparing Popular Soil Mix Recipes

    When filling new frames or containers, you have several popular recipes to choose from. Let us look at how two of the most famous mixes compare.

    Feature

    Mel’s Mix

    The Perfect Soil Recipe

    Bagged Garden Mix

    Composition

    1/3 Peat Moss, 1/3 Vermiculite, 1/3 Blended Compost

    50% Topsoil, 30% Compost, 20% Organic Matter

    100% Commercial Bagged Mix

    Drainage

    Excellent, lightweight and fluffy

    Moderate to Good, depends on topsoil quality

    Variable, can compact over time

    Cost

    High (Vermiculite and Peat are expensive)

    Moderate (Uses bulk local materials)

    High (Buying individual bags adds up)

    Longevity

    Requires heavy compost replenishment yearly

    Highly durable, holds structure well

    Breaks down quickly, needs frequent topping

    Best For

    Shallow boxes, square foot gardening

    Deep frames, long-term sustainability

    Small containers, quick setup

    Step-by-Step Guide to Preparing Your Beds

    Preparation is everything. The work you do weeks before you plant dictates the health of your harvest months later.

    Clearing and Weeding

    Start by removing all existing weeds and grass. Never till aggressive perennial weeds into the dirt, as chopping their roots will simply multiply them. Remove them entirely by hand. If you are starting a brand new plot, consider smothering the grass with thick layers of cardboard topped with a thick layer of decayed matter, a technique known as sheet mulching.

    Adding the Nutrients

    Spread a two-inch layer of decayed matter over the entire surface of your bed. Sprinkle your granular natural fertilizer according to the package directions. Use a broadfork or a digging fork to gently loosen the ground and incorporate the amendments into the top few inches. Avoid aggressive rototilling, as it destroys the delicate underground web of fungal networks and kills earthworms.

    Protecting the Surface

    Never leave your ground naked and exposed to the elements. Implementing a thick layer of mulching protects the surface from baking sun, pounding rain, and drying winds. Spread straw, shredded leaves, or clean grass clippings around your plants. This protective blanket suppresses weeds, traps vital moisture, and slowly breaks down to feed the microbes below, vastly improving overall soil health.

    Maximizing Microbial Life

    The secret to explosive vegetable growth lies not in feeding the plant, but in feeding the microbes that feed the plant.

    The Soil Food Web

    A healthy garden contains a microscopic jungle. Bacteria and fungi break down tough organic matter into simple, water-soluble nutrients that plant roots can absorb. In exchange, plants release sugary exudates through their roots to feed the microbes. Fungal networks act as an extension of the plant’s root system, reaching far and wide to gather water and minerals.

    Encouraging Earthworms

    Earthworms are the ultimate garden helpers. They tunnel through the dirt, creating channels for air and water. They consume decaying matter and excrete castings that are richer in nutrients than the surrounding dirt. To attract earthworms, keep your beds moist, add plenty of leafy green compost, and avoid using synthetic chemical fertilizers or pesticides that harm them.

    Expert Tips for Long-Term Success

    Growing vegetables is a marathon, not a sprint. Follow these expert guidelines to ensure your garden remains productive year after year.

    • Rotate Your Crops: Never plant the same family of vegetables in the same spot two years in a row. Crop rotation prevents the depletion of specific nutrients and breaks the life cycle of overwintering pests and diseases.
    • Grow Cover Crops: When a bed sits empty in the fall, plant a cover crop like winter rye, clover, or vetch. These plants protect the surface from erosion, fix nitrogen from the air, and add massive amounts of organic matter when you chop them down in the spring.
    • Keep it Aerated: Roots need oxygen to survive. Avoid stepping on your growing beds, as foot traffic causes severe compaction. Create dedicated walking paths and reach into the beds to harvest and weed.
    • Use Worm Castings: If you want a massive boost of immediate nutrition, sprinkle a handful of worm castings directly into the planting hole when transplanting seedlings.

    Common Mistakes to Avoid

    Even experienced growers make mistakes. Avoid these common pitfalls to keep your vegetable garden thriving.

    • Working Wet Dirt: Never dig, fork, or till your beds immediately after a heavy rain. Working wet dirt destroys its structure, turning it into dense, brick-like clods that restrict root growth.
    • Using Peat Moss Excessively: While peat moss lightens mixes, it is highly acidic and lacks nutrients. Furthermore, harvesting peat releases massive amounts of carbon into the atmosphere. Use sustainable alternatives like coconut coir or composted leaf mold instead.
    • Skipping the Mulch: Leaving the ground bare invites a host of problems. Weeds will take over rapidly, the sun will evaporate your water, and heavy rain will wash away your topsoil. Always cover the surface.
    • Ignoring pH Levels: You can add hundreds of dollars worth of premium fertilizer to your beds, but if your pH is highly alkaline or highly acidic, your plants will slowly starve to death. Test your levels and amend with lime to raise pH or elemental sulfur to lower it.
    • Using Fresh Manure: Never put fresh chicken, horse, or cow manure directly onto your vegetable beds. It contains high levels of ammonia that will severely burn your plants and may contain dangerous pathogens. Always age it for at least six months first.

    Seasonal Maintenance Routines

    Seasonal Maintenance Routines

    Maintaining the best soil for vegetable gardening requires year-round attention. Each season brings new tasks.

    Spring Preparations

    In early spring, pull back the winter protective covering to allow the sun to warm the dark ground. Perform your yearly testing. Top dress your beds with fresh decayed organic matter and gently fork in your chosen natural fertilizers. Allow the beds to rest for at least a week before planting your early cool-season crops like peas and radishes.

    Summer Upkeep

    During the intense heat of summer, your main focus shifts to moisture retention. Maintain a thick protective layer over the ground to stop evaporation. Apply a liquid fish emulsion or kelp tea every few weeks to give heavy-fruiting plants like tomatoes and peppers a quick nutritional boost. Monitor for signs of nutrient deficiency, such as yellowing lower leaves, and address them promptly.

    Fall Winterizing

    When the harvest ends, clean up all diseased plant debris and throw it in the trash, not the compost pile. Leave healthy roots in the ground to decay naturally. Plant a cover crop or apply a thick layer of shredded autumn leaves over the entire bed. This winterizes the ground, protecting the microbial life from freezing temperatures and setting you up for massive success the following spring.

    Frequently Asked Questions

    What is the ideal pH for growing vegetables?

    Most vegetables thrive in a slightly acidic environment with a pH between 6.5 and 6.8. This specific range allows the roots to absorb macro and micronutrients efficiently. If the pH strays too far outside this range, nutrient lockout occurs.

    Can I use regular potting mix in my garden beds?

    Regular potting mix is designed for containers and pots. It is very light and usually lacks the long-term nutritional profile required for large outdoor beds. You should use a heavier, nutrient-dense blend of topsoil and decayed organic matter for outdoor framing.

    How often should I add compost to my garden?

    You should add a fresh layer of decayed organic matter to your beds at least once a year, preferably in the early spring or late fall. Adding one to two inches annually replenishes the nutrients that heavy-feeding vegetables pull out of the ground.

    Is it necessary to buy expensive bagged dirt?

    No, you do not need to buy expensive commercial bags. You can create highly fertile ground using local bulk topsoil mixed with homemade decayed matter, aged animal manure, and affordable natural amendments.

    Why are my tomato leaves turning yellow at the bottom?

    Yellowing lower leaves usually indicate a nitrogen deficiency. The plant pulls nitrogen from older foliage to support new top growth. Feeding the plant with a quality organic fertilizer or liquid fish emulsion typically resolves the issue quickly.

    How deep should my raised garden beds be?

    For optimal vegetable root growth, elevated frames should be at least 12 to 15 inches deep. Deep-rooted crops like tomatoes, carrots, and potatoes perform significantly better when they have ample room to stretch downward without hitting hard native dirt.

    What is the best way to improve heavy clay?

    The most effective way to break up dense clay is by incorporating massive amounts of organic matter, such as compost and decomposed leaves. You can also add gypsum to help loosen the clay particles and improve water drainage over time.

    Should I use peat moss in my garden?

    While it retains moisture well, peat moss is highly acidic, lacks nutrients, and is environmentally controversial due to carbon release during harvesting. Sustainable alternatives like coconut coir or composted leaf mold provide the same benefits without the negative drawbacks.

    When should I use natural fertilizers?

    You should apply slow-release granular natural fertilizers when preparing your beds in the spring and whenever you transplant new seedlings. You can supplement with liquid natural fertilizers during the summer when plants are actively setting heavy fruit.

    How do I know if my garden is draining properly?

    Dig a hole roughly twelve inches deep and fill it with water. Allow it to drain completely, then fill it again. If the second round of water takes more than a few hours to drain, you have poor drainage and need to add significantly more organic matter to improve aeration.
